| 1.Read all instructions before operating the air
cleaner. 2. Place air cleaner where it is not easily
knocked over by persons in the household.
3. Always unplug when not in use.
4. Do not use any product with a damaged cord or plug
or if product malfunctions, is dropped or damaged in any manner. Keep the cord away from
heated surfaces.
5. Do not use air cleaner outdoors.
6. Never use air cleaner unless it is fully assembled.
7. Do not run power cord under carpets, and do not cover with throw rugs. Arrange cord such
that it will not be tripped over.
8. Do not use air cleaner where combustible gases or
vapors are present.
9. Do not expose the air cleaner to rain, or use near
water, in a bathroom, laundry area or other damp location.
10. To disconnect the air cleaner, first turn speed
control to OFF position and remove plug from the outlet.
11. The air cleaner must be used in its upright position.
12. Do not allow foreign objects to enter ventilation or
exhaust opening as this may cause electric shock or damage to the air cleaner. Do not
block air outlets or intakes.
13. Locate air cleaner near power outlet and avoid using an extension cord.
14. The air cleaner has a polarized plug (one blade is wider than the other). To reduce risk
of shock, this plug is intended to fit in a polarized outlet only one way. If the plug
does not fit fully in the outlet, reverse the plug. If it still does not fit, contact a
qualified electrician. DO NOT attempt to defeat this safety feature.
15. A loose fit between the plug and the AC outlet
(receptacle) may cause overheating and a distortion of the plug. Contact a qualified
electrician to replace loose or worn receptacles.
16. Do not sit, stand or place heavy objects on the air
cleaner.
17. Disconnect power supply before servicing. |
